Introduction

The cable assembly market is witnessing substantial growth, driven by increasing demand for high-speed data transmission, industrial automation, and the expansion of communication networks. Cable assemblies, which bundle multiple cables into a single unit, are essential in industries such as automotive, aerospace, telecommunications, healthcare, and consumer electronics. With advancements in connectivity solutions and rising adoption of smart technologies, the market is expected to expand further in the coming years.

Market Overview

Cable assemblies are designed to improve efficiency, reduce installation time, and enhance durability in various applications. They include fiber optic, coaxial, power, data, and RF (radio frequency) cable assemblies, catering to different industry needs. The growing complexity of electronic systems and increasing demand for reliable connections are key factors fueling market growth.

Key Growth Drivers

1. Expansion of 5G Networks and Telecommunications

The rapid deployment of 5G technology and increasing reliance on high-speed internet connectivity are driving demand for advanced cable assemblies. Fiber optic cable assemblies, in particular, are experiencing strong growth due to their role in high-bandwidth data transmission.

2. Rise of Industrial Automation and IoT

Industries are increasingly adopting automation, robotics, and IoT-based solutions, all of which require reliable and high-performance cable assemblies for seamless connectivity and data exchange.

3. Growing Automotive Electronics Market

With the rise of electric vehicles (EVs) and autonomous driving technology, the demand for specialized cable assemblies in automotive applications has surged. These assemblies are crucial for power distribution, data communication, and safety systems.

4. Demand in Aerospace and Defense Applications

The aerospace and defense sectors require high-reliability cable assemblies for avionics, satellite communications, radar systems, and military-grade electronic equipment. Increased investments in defense and space exploration are fueling market expansion.

5. Healthcare and Medical Devices Growth

Cable assemblies play a critical role in medical imaging systems, diagnostic devices, and wearable healthcare technology. The rise in telemedicine and advanced medical equipment is boosting demand in this segment.

Market Challenges

High Manufacturing Costs

The production of high-performance cable assemblies, especially those designed for aerospace, defense, and industrial applications, involves complex manufacturing processes and strict quality standards, leading to higher costs.

Supply Chain Disruptions

Global supply chain disruptions, material shortages, and fluctuating raw material prices can impact the availability and pricing of cable assemblies.

Miniaturization and Integration Challenges

As electronic devices become more compact, manufacturers face challenges in designing and integrating smaller, more efficient cable assemblies without compromising performance.
